Output 246c6c04786afd26ca490cc60c29e8ea83f06a3e4e771cd9638727e85860792b:1

value
599176737
script pubkey
OP_0 OP_PUSHBYTES_20 eff50bfb637a6fc0f33b62039ea9a6a9d98d39dc
address
ltc1qal6sh7mr0fhupuemvgpea2dx48vc6wwup55n5e
transaction
246c6c04786afd26ca490cc60c29e8ea83f06a3e4e771cd9638727e85860792b
spent
true